Stainless steel barrel welding machine
Technical Field
The invention relates to the technical field of welding, in particular to a stainless steel barrel welding machine.
Background
Welding is a common process flow in the metal production and processing process, the welding quality directly determines the final quality of a product, generally, the process flow is that welding technicians manually perform welding operation, the welding quality directly depends on the welding technical level of the welding technicians, the manual welding efficiency of the welding technicians is low, the quality fluctuation is large, welding spots often shake, the welding spots are not smooth and attractive enough, and the product quality is not up to the standard; the stainless steel heating barrel usually needs to weld the barrel cover and the barrel body together in the production process, namely, the edge of the stainless steel barrel is welded, manual welding is usually adopted in production, but the manual welding efficiency is low, the quality fluctuation is large, and in the prior art, a circular welding machine is adopted for welding operation, so that the accuracy is poor, the automation degree is low, and the production efficiency is influenced.

Detailed Description
In order to make the technical problems, technical solutions and advantages of the present invention more apparent, the following detailed description is given with reference to the accompanying drawings and specific embodiments.
The invention provides a stainless steel barrel welding machine, aiming at the problems that the existing manual welding machine has low efficiency and large quality fluctuation, a circular welding machine is adopted for welding operation, the accuracy is poor, the automation degree is low, and the production efficiency is influenced.
As shown in fig. 1 to 4, an embodiment of the present invention provides a stainless steel barrel welding machine, including: the welding device comprises a welding cabinet 1, wherein an operating platform 2 is arranged in the welding cabinet 1; the fixed rotating assembly comprises a rotating base 3 and a rotating motor 4, the rotating base 3 is arranged on the operating platform 2 in a penetrating mode, and a rotating fixing frame 5 is arranged at the top of the rotating base 3; a rotating shaft 6 is arranged at the bottom of the rotating base 3, and a driven gear 7 is arranged at the bottom end of the rotating shaft 6; the rotating motor 4 is erected below the operating platform 2, an output shaft of the rotating motor 4 is provided with a driving gear 8, and the driving gear 8 is meshed with the driven gear 7; the welding assembly comprises a welding frame 9, the welding frame 9 is arranged behind the rotary fixing frame 5, two supporting columns of the welding frame 9 are respectively provided with a lifting slide rail 10, two lifting slide rails 10 are provided with lifting frames 11, the lifting frames 11 are in sliding connection with the lifting slide rails 10 through sliding blocks, the top of the welding frame 9 is provided with a lifting cylinder 12, a push rod of the lifting cylinder 12 is connected with the top of the welding cabinet 1, and the other end of the lifting cylinder 12 is fixedly connected with the lifting frames 11; the bottom of crane 11 is provided with two flexible slide rails 13, two be provided with a expansion plate 14 on the flexible slide rail 13, expansion plate 14 with through slider sliding connection between the flexible slide rail 13, 14 backs of expansion plate are provided with a telescopic cylinder 15, telescopic cylinder 15's push rod with expansion plate 14 connects, be provided with a welder support 16 on the expansion plate 14, be provided with welder 17 on the welder support 16.
According to the stainless steel barrel welding machine disclosed by the embodiment of the invention, the stainless steel barrel body and the barrel cover are placed on the rotating base 3, the rotating motor 4 starts to rotate, the rotating speed of the rotating motor 4 is adjustable, the driving gear 8 is arranged on the output shaft of the rotating motor 4, the driving gear 8 drives the driven gear 7 to drive the rotating shaft 6 and the rotating base 3 to rotate, and therefore the fixed stainless steel barrel body and the barrel cover can rotate along with the rotating base 3 according to the rotating speed of the rotating motor 4; the welding frame 9 is provided with the lifting frame 11, the lifting frame 11 realizes up-and-down displacement through the lifting slide rail 10 and the lifting cylinder 12, the lifting frame 11 is provided with the expansion plate 14, the expansion plate 14 realizes front-and-back displacement through the expansion slide rail 13 and the expansion cylinder 15, the welding gun support 16 is arranged on the expansion plate 14, so that the welding gun support 16 can flexibly move up and down and back and forth, the welding gun 17 also moves along with the welding gun support 16, and a stainless steel barrel body and a barrel cover are welded at a proper position.
The fixed rotating assembly and the welding assembly are respectively provided with two sets which are respectively arranged on two sides in the welding cabinet.
As shown in fig. 1, a plurality of smoke outlets 18 are formed in the top of the welding cabinet, and the smoke outlets 18 are respectively arranged above each group of the fixed rotating assemblies and the welding assemblies.
According to the stainless steel barrel welding machine disclosed by the embodiment of the invention, the fixed rotating assembly and the welding assembly are respectively provided with two sets, and the top of the welding cabinet is respectively provided with the smoke outlet 18, so that redundant waste gas generated by welding can be timely discharged while double-station efficient welding is realized, and an operator can operate the welding machine in a better environment.
The rotary base 3 is provided with a rotary boss 19, the rotary boss 19 is used for placing a fixed barrel wall 20, a through hole is formed in the top of the rotary fixing frame 5, and the fixed barrel wall 20 penetrates through the through hole of the rotary fixing frame 5.
As shown in fig. 4, a dismounting groove 21 is formed at one side of the through hole of the rotary fixing frame 5, and a positioning buckle 22 is respectively arranged at the front end and the rear end of the through hole of the rotary fixing frame 5.
According to the welding machine for the stainless steel barrel, the fixed barrel wall 20 is manually placed in the through hole of the rotary fixing frame 5, the positioning buckle 22 is further arranged on the rotary fixing frame 5, the fixed barrel wall 20 can be fixed by the positioning buckle 22 after being placed in the through hole of the rotary fixing frame 5, the disassembly groove 21 is beneficial for an operator to disassemble the fixed barrel wall 20, and after the fixed barrel wall 20 is arranged, the positioning can be completed only by placing a stainless steel barrel body and a barrel cover in the fixed barrel wall 20.
As shown in fig. 3 and 4, the welding gun support 16 is provided with a fixing plate 23, the fixing plate 23 is provided with a plurality of fixing screw holes, the fixing plate 23 is provided with a rotating frame 24, the rotating frame 24 is provided with an arc-shaped groove and a main fixing hole, the rotating frame 24 is installed on the fixing plate through a bolt, the arc-shaped groove and the main fixing hole in a matching manner, and the welding gun 17 is installed on the rotating frame 24.
According to the welding machine for the stainless steel barrel in the embodiment of the invention, the arc-shaped groove and the main fixing hole are formed in the rotating frame 24, so that the position of the rotating frame 24 relative to the fixing plate 23 can be adjusted after the bolt of the rotating frame 24 is loosened, the rotating frame 24 is fixed again at a proper position through the matching of the bolt and the fixing screw hole in the fixing plate 23, and the welding gun 17 can change the welding angle along with the position change of the rotating frame 24.
Wherein, a touch control screen 25 is further arranged between the two welding frames 9.
According to the stainless steel barrel welding machine disclosed by the embodiment of the invention, the touch control screen 25 is placed in the middle of the equipment, so that an operator can operate the machine conveniently.
According to the stainless steel barrel welding machine provided by the embodiment of the invention, the welding cabinet is used as a base, the operation platform is arranged in the welding cabinet, the fixed rotating assembly is arranged on the operation platform, and after the stainless steel barrel body and the barrel cover are placed behind the fixed barrel wall, the rotating motor can drive the whole fixed rotating assembly to rotate, so that the stainless steel barrel body can start to rotate, the welding assembly which adjusts the up-down front-back position and the rotating angle of the rotating frame in advance can weld the stainless steel barrel body and the barrel cover, the production efficiency is greatly improved by arranging two groups of the fixed rotating assembly and the welding assembly, the exhaust port can timely exhaust waste gas generated by welding, the fixed barrel wall can be manually fixed in the rotating fixing frame, the position where the stainless steel barrel body is placed can be better positioned, and the touch screen arranged in the middle part enables an operator to operate the welding machine more conveniently; the welding device is simple in structure, convenient and fast to operate, the rotating speed during welding can be adjusted, the stainless steel barrel body and the barrel cover can be welded together in the stable rotating process, welding spots are smooth and attractive, the welding efficiency is greatly improved, and the production quality requirements of products are met.
